SYY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2017 in Review

1,023 of the 4,011 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Sysco (SYY) for Q2 2017, worth a combined $21.6B — down 2.9% from $22.3B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 68 funds opened new SYY positions and 61 closed out — a net gain of 7 holders — while 325 added to existing stakes and 429 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Janus Henderson Group, adding an estimated $301M. The largest seller was Bank of Montreal, cutting an estimated $70.3M.
